I have a 96 7.3 F350, pretty sure I have a fuel issue, but not sure where and was wondering if anyone else has ran into this.
I've been through several threads on the subject, but the ones I've found don't seem to quite fit the symptoms. Pretty much all of them say something in the electronics, but that doesn't seem right to me.
In the mornings while it's cold it'll cut out multiple times for a half a second or so for around 3 to 5 miles then clear up and run fine the rest of the day.
Now I'm discovering that if I try to run 65-70 that within 5 minutes it'll cut out too. I can back off the throttle a hair and it's fine.
Any idea where I should start looking for this? I'm thinking about going ahead and rebuilding the fuel bowl, been a many a miles since I've done that.

Yea, the tach drops a few hundred rpm, about what I would expect for an engine cutting out, doesn't drop to zero.
I did about a 200 mile trip today, runs great as long as you don't go above 65, at 70 within a minute or two it'll start bucking. It's saying to me I'm not getting enough fuel. I really don't think there's anything wrong with the injector firing system.
OK, on further inspection I did find that my ICP sensor is broken, that is part of the fuel system, so I'm hoping that's the issue. I've got a new one ordered from Riff Raff, so we'll see what happens after I install it.
